"They" the Children


Act as though you were going to write a story similar to "Flower Children" about your own family or The Kinkaid School. Write an introductory paragraph using a 3rd person, "they", omniscient narrator (see the first paragraph of "Flower Children" for reference) in which the reader gets a clear idea about the family or students, home or school, and values of the characters. Insert your paragraph into a comment below this post.

"We Can Have Everything"

Ebro Mountains, Spain

In "Hills Like White Elephants", what is the central conflict? How do you know? Also, what can we infer from indirect clues about the characters' ages, their probable decision, and their inner thoughts as opposed to what they actually say out loud? (Please refer directly to the text when possible.)
